Varèse Sarabande Records has released The Buddy Holly Story Original Motion Picture Soundtrack (Deluxe Edition), with all songs from the Academy Award®-winning film now available for the first time on all digital streaming platforms, LP, and CD. The LP includes a printed inner sleeve, and the CD a 16-page booklet, which includes rare photos of the icon, courtesy of his estate and The Buddy Holly Educational Foundation (tbhef.org).
The expanded soundtrack features 22 tracks in total, including 11 tracks not released on the original soundtrack. The additional songs include many performances that were in the film, such as “That’ll Be the Day,” “Mockingbird Hill” and “Tennessee Waltz” performed by Gary Busey (as Buddy Holly), “Chantilly Lace” performed by Gailard Sartain (as the Big Bopper) and “You Send Me” performed by Paul Mooney (as Sam Cooke).

Buddy Holly is one of the most revered musicians in rock and roll history, one of the original ten members of the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ame who inspired artists from Dylan to the Beatles, Dolly Parton, and Ed Sheeran, and The Buddy Holly Story was his definitive biographic film. The project earned three Oscar® nominations, including “Best Actor” for prolific character actor Gary Busey, who has appeared in over 150 films, including Lethal Weapon and Point Break. Holly’s legacy is still going strong today, as he remains a chart topper in the U.K. and 2018’s Buddy Holly with the Royal Philharmonic Orchestra was a top-ten hit on the Billboard charts. A recent tour of the U.S. and the E.U. featuring a hologram of Buddy Holly grossed millions of dollars. As the graffiti at the Rock Hall says, “Buddy Lives!”
